On Saturday, UNC-Chapel Hill students packed into the Gate 5 entrance of Kenan Stadium to get into the student section at this season’s home opener against the UNC-Charlotte 49ers.
For some, going and seeing the game is fun on its own, but many students use game days to show off their style and Tar Heel pride.
The Daily Tar Heel asked fans what they were wearing to the game, and why:

Trilla Teague went to the student gate in bedazzled cream-colored cowgirl boots and a denim dress. She said she got the boots for Christmas her senior year of high school and that they are the best gift she has ever received.
“Number one pair of shoes I own, easily,” she said.
Teague also expressed excitement and anticipation over the return to football season. She said that she was pumped about getting to cheer for the Tar Heels again.

Junior Catherine Campo wore a gradient blue, handmadecrocheted top. She said it took her a while to get started making the top, but only six hours once she was determined to finish it.
“I actually started it last summer, but I didn't finish it until this past spring break,” she said. “So I’m very excited I get to wear it today.”

One of Campo’s friends, fellow junior Leah Vasbinder, showed her school spirit not just with her clothes, but also her makeup. Her bright blue eyeliner is normally the centerpiece of her game day outfits, she said.
Vasbinder also said she was excited for the football season. Despite the heat, she said the game was going to be worth it.
“I don’t know how the team’s gonna be, but I’m just here for a good time,” she said.

Sophomore Cameron Wheeler was also thrilled to be at the game and back in the stadium. He was wearing a bucket hat that he got at a women’s soccer game in the spring.
“I miss Kenan,” he said. “I had such a good time almost every game last year, so it feels good to be back here.”
